  1. fitted new second( in pipe) lambda sensor. light still on codes read PO136.02. POo36.08. PO136.11. still looks like faulty lambda . have today taken it back and changed it for another new one still the same codes. cleared them but back again. the EML did go off a couple of weeks ago but came back on after 4 days. Lambda sensor make CAMBIARE. car runs well no hesitation very smooth. I was a mechanic for 30 yrs but new territory to me , any help appreciated.
